Our new Perinatal Psychiatry Consultation Line led by Deb Cowley allows any health care provider in Washington State to receive consultation, recommendations, and referrals to community resources from a UW psychiatrist with expertise in perinatal mental health. Modeled after the successful child psychiatry telehealth PAL program, faculty members consult on any mental health-related questions for patients who are pregnant, in the first year postpartum, or who have pregnancy-related complications (e.g. pregnancy loss or infertility). Topics may include depression, anxiety, or other psychiatric disorders; adjustment to pregnancy loss, complications, or difficult life events; risks of psychiatric medications; and non-medication treatments. This new telepsychiatry consultation service aims to improve patient care throughout Washington State. In addition, it will significantly enhance providers’ knowledge about treating mental health conditions during pregnancy and postpartum, increasing the capacity of the Washington medical system to deliver effective mental health care.
